Abstract

The invention discloses a credit exchange method and a device based on a mobile banking, which relate to the field of artificial intelligence, and the method comprises the following steps: after a user logs in a mobile phone bank, judging whether the user is real-name authentication; if the authentication is real-name authentication, adding a mobile phone number through a mobile phone bank, judging the affiliated operator based on the mobile phone number, and finishing the mutual trust operation between the mobile phone bank and the affiliated operator; after mutual communication is completed, the mobile phone number is sent to the affiliated operator, and the affiliated operator returns the integral under the corresponding mobile phone number; and carrying out commodity exchange based on the points, and deducting the corresponding points from the affiliated operator after the exchange is successful. According to the invention, the mobile phone numbers under a plurality of user names can be added and exchanged in a centralized manner through the mobile phone bank, so that the customer experience is improved, and more customers are attracted.

Background
This section is intended to provide a background or context to the embodiments of the invention that are recited in the claims. The description herein is not admitted to be prior art by inclusion in this section.
At present, the mobile phone number points of users in each operator are mutually independent, the points under a plurality of user names cannot be exchanged in a centralized mode, the points of different operators under the same user name cannot be exchanged in a centralized mode, and due to the fact that few points of some users can be exchanged, the users give up exchanging, and the points are wasted.

Interpretation of terms:
token: the server generates a string of character strings to serve as a Token requested by the client, after the server logs in for the first time, the server generates a Token to return the Token to the client, and the client only needs to bring the Token to request data before the client later.
Fig. 1 is a first flowchart of a point redemption method based on a mobile banking in the emb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 1, the method includes:
step 101: after a user logs in a mobile phone bank, judging whether the user is real-name authentication;
step 102: if the authentication is real-name authentication, adding a mobile phone number through a mobile phone bank, judging the affiliated operator based on the mobile phone number, and finishing the mutual trust operation between the mobile phone bank and the affiliated operator;
step 103: after mutual communication is completed, the mobile phone number is sent to the affiliated operator, and the affiliated operator returns the integral under the corresponding mobile phone number;
step 104: and carrying out commodity exchange based on the points, and deducting the corresponding points from the affiliated operator after the exchange is successful.
In the emb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 2, the method further includes:
step 201: and if the non-real-name authentication is judged, performing real-name authentication.
Specifically, after the user logs in the mobile phone bank, whether the user is authenticated by the real name or not is judged, and if the user is authenticated by the real name, the subsequent exchange operation is allowed; and if the user is a non-real-name authentication user, guiding the user to perform real-name authentication, namely, using the existing bank card binding function to realize the real-name authentication of the user, and performing exchange operation after authentication.
In the emb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 3, step 102 determines the affiliated operator based on the mobile phone number, and completes the mutual trust operation between the mobile phone bank and the affiliated operator, including:
step 301: judging the affiliated operator based on the mobile phone number, sending the unique character string and the user ID of the login mobile phone bank to the affiliated operator through a mobile phone bank, receiving a token returned by the affiliated operator, and finishing mutual trust;
and the operator inquires the three elements of the login mobile phone bank user in the mobile phone bank according to the unique character string and the login mobile phone bank user ID, checks the inquired three elements with the three elements stored by the operator, and returns token after checking.
Specifically, the user can add the mobile phone number score of any user to the name of the user at the mobile phone bank end. When the user adds the mobile phone number integration, the operator is judged according to the mobile phone number, the mobile phone bank end sends a unique character string and a user ID to the operator, and the unique character string is called CODE for short. After receiving the CODE and the user ID, the operator queries four elements of the user at a mobile banking end through the CODE and the user ID, wherein the four elements comprise: name, certificate type, certificate number, mobile phone number. And after the operator takes the four elements of the user, the operator finishes checking the user information stored by the operator, and if the checking is successful, the token is returned to the mobile phone bank end to finish the mutual trust process. Any subsequent request initiated by the mobile banking terminal needs to be uploaded to the token. And if the operator checks the inquired three elements with the three elements stored by the operator, and if the check fails, returning mutual trust failure information.
Different operators can return different tokens, and when the mobile phone bank sends a request to the corresponding operator, the corresponding token can be uploaded.
In the emb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 4, step 103 sends the mobile phone number to the affiliated operator, and the affiliated operator returns the score under the corresponding mobile phone number, where the method includes:
step 401: and sending the mobile phone number to the affiliated operator, sending a short message verification code to the corresponding mobile phone number by the affiliated operator, inputting the short message verification code through a mobile phone bank, sending the short message verification code to the corresponding operator, verifying by the corresponding operator, and receiving the credit under the corresponding mobile phone number returned by the operator if the verification is passed. After the mobile phone bank receives the points, the subsequent users can check and use the points if the points are added successfully.
Specifically, if the mobile phone number belongs to the mobile phone number under the user name of the login mobile phone bank, the mobile phone bank and the operator realize mutual trust, and the authentication can be completed even if the short message verification code is not passed. However, when the mobile phone number does not belong to the mobile phone number under the login mobile phone bank user name, authentication needs to be completed, and the risk problem is prevented.
The input mobile phone number may include the own mobile phone number of the login mobile banking user, or may be the mobile phone number of the user (such as a friend, a relative, a colleague, and the like) related to the login mobile banking user, as long as the login mobile banking user can legally obtain the mobile phone number and the verification code of the other party.
In the emb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 5, step 104 is to perform commodity redemption based on the points, and includes:
step 501: and during exchange, judging whether the scores under each mobile phone number are sufficient, if so, directly utilizing the sufficient scores to exchange, and if not, after the score of one mobile phone number is used up, continuing to use the score of the next mobile phone number until the score meets the required score for commodity exchange.
Specifically, after the user successfully adds the mobile phone number credits, all the added credits can be checked. If the user adds 500 credits for a friend and 1000 credits for a colleague, the user has 1500 credits. The user can use the points in a centralized manner to select commodities for exchange, and after the exchange is successful, corresponding points are deducted from the operator respectively. If the user redeems the points for 1300, wherein the points 500 are moved and the points 800 are telecom, the points 500 and 800 are deducted from the mobile and telecom operators respectively.
And accumulating and using the points corresponding to the mobile phone numbers during exchange. And judging whether the credit under each mobile phone number is sufficient, and if not, continuing to use the credit of the next mobile phone number until the required credit for redemption is met.
